§ 571.06 — License; application, fee, and conditions

(1)Application for license to reproduce or use a seal of quality shall be made to the department on application forms supplied by the department. Anyone making application and payment of license fee in the amount of $10 and meeting other qualifications required under this part and rules adopted hereunder shall be granted license for which applied. Such license shall be valid for 1 year from date of issue. The department, however, may refuse to issue a license to any person whose license has been revoked until such person demonstrates to the department that he or she no longer will violate the provisions of this part or rules adopted hereunder.
